Supervisor / User Password

When you select this function, the following message will appear at the center of the screen to assist you
in creating a password.

Type the password, up to eight characters, and press <Enter>. The password typed now will clear the
previously entered password from CMOS memory. You will be asked to confirm the password. Type
the password again and press <Enter>.
To disable password, just press <Enter> when you are prompted to enter password. A message
"PASSWORD DISABLED" will appear to confirm the password being disabled. Once the password is
disabled, the system will boot and you can enter Setup freely.
If you select Always at Security Option in BIOS Features Setup Menu, you will be prompted for the
password every time the system is rebooted or any time you try to enter Setup Menu. If you select
Setup at Security Option in BIOS Features Setup Menu, you will be prompted only when you try to
enter Setup.
